Ammonia assimilation by Ruminococcus flavefaciens FD-1

Studies were conducted to better understand the mechanism by which Ruminococcus flavefaciens FD-1 utilizes ammonia (-um). $\sp{14}$C-methyl-ammonium was not taken up by R. flavefaciens FD-1, but cells prepared similarly depleted ammonia from media (initial rates of 11.2 and 0.8 nmol$\cdot$min$\sp{-1}{\cdot}$mg$\sp{-1}$ protein for cells grown with limiting nitrogen and carbon, respectively).
